What Is a Slot Canyon?

A slot canyon is a narrow, deep, and elongated canyon formed primarily by water erosion through soft rock (usually sandstone or limestone).
It is much deeper than it is wide—some are only a few feet across but can reach tens of meters in depth.
The smooth, wave-like walls and the play of light and shadow make them some of the most photogenic natural wonders on Earth.

Most slot canyons in the world are found in the American Southwest, particularly on the Colorado Plateau, where layers of soft sandstone have been shaped by flash floods for millions of years.
The dry desert climate, occasional violent rainstorms, and unique geological structure make this region ideal for the formation of slot canyons.

The Birth of a Slot Canyon

Slot canyons are born through a combination of right kind of rock, geological uplift, and flash floods. Three key conditions must come together for a slot canyon to form.

  • Type of Rock Layers

The first requirement for a slot canyon to form is the right kind of rock.
Most slot canyons are carved into sandstone or limestone, which strike a perfect balance between strength and softness. These sedimentary rocks are hard enough to maintain steep, vertical walls but soft enough to be slowly eroded by flowing water.

In the Colorado Plateau—which spans parts of Arizona, Utah, Colorado, and New Mexico—these rock layers are especially common. Over hundreds of millions of years, the region experienced shifting environments: ancient oceans, river deltas, and desert dune fields.
During marine periods, shells, corals, and chemical sediments accumulated on the seafloor, forming thick beds of limestone. Later, during dry desert ages, winds piled sand dunes hundreds of feet high; under pressure, these dunes compacted into sandstone, such as the famous Navajo Sandstone that shapes much of the Southwest’s canyon landscape.

These thick, relatively uniform rock layers provide the perfect “canvas” for nature to sculpt slot canyons—resisting collapse while allowing water to carve through over immense spans of time.

  • Crustal Uplift and Rock Fractures

The second key factor is tectonic uplift, which exposes the rock layers and creates the initial cracks that guide future erosion.
Around 70 million years ago, during the Laramide Orogeny, the Colorado Plateau was slowly lifted thousands of feet above sea level. Unlike many mountain ranges that folded or broke apart during uplift, the plateau rose mostly intact, preserving its layered structure.

This uplift caused vertical joints and fractures to form in the sandstone and limestone. These cracks became natural pathways for rainwater and floodwater. Once the rock was exposed at the surface, it was vulnerable to weathering—and those fractures served as starting points for canyons to develop.

Without uplift and fracturing, there would be no vertical cracks for water to follow, and the dramatic, narrow canyons we see today could never exist.

  • Short but Intense Rainfall (Flash Floods)

The final—and most dramatic—ingredient is flash flooding.
Slot canyons typically form in arid or semi-arid regions, where rainfall is rare but often arrives in short, violent bursts.
When sudden storms strike the desert, rainwater rushes over the bare sandstone surface, collecting into narrow channels and plunging into the existing cracks and joints.

These flash floods carry sand, gravel, and debris that act like liquid sandpaper, grinding against the canyon walls with tremendous force. Over thousands—or even millions—of years, this process deepens, widens, and polishes the cracks into smooth, twisting corridors of stone.

Each flood carves a little deeper, leaving behind the elegant curves and flowing shapes that define a slot canyon.

In summary, the formation of a slot canyon requires a perfect geological balance:

  • Strong yet erodible rock layers, like sandstone and limestone.
  • Tectonic uplift that creates fractures and exposes the rock.
  • Powerful flash floods that carve through those fractures over time.

Together, these forces—earth, water, and time—create one of the most stunning landscapes on the planet.

Why Antelope Canyon Fits the Definition

Now that we understand what a slot canyon is and how it forms, let’s return to the question in the title: does Antelope Canyon qualify as a slot canyon? If we take the geological definition of a slot canyon and compare it to Antelope Canyon, every characteristic aligns perfectly.

How Antelope Canyon Fits the Feature

Type of Rock Layer – Navajo Sandstone

Antelope Canyon is carved entirely into Navajo Sandstone, one of the most famous and visually striking rock formations on the Colorado Plateau. This sandstone is both strong enough to form steep, narrow walls and soft enough to be shaped by flowing water. Its fine grains and iron-rich minerals give the canyon its signature red and orange hues, which glow beautifully under sunlight.

Erosional Mechanism – Flash Floods

The canyon owes its existence to countless flash floods that have swept through the area over thousands of years. These floods originate from the higher desert mesas and drainage basins above the canyon—especially from the flat, open plains that surround Page, Arizona. During sudden desert rainstorms, rainwater cannot soak into the hard sandstone surface; instead, it rushes downhill, converging into narrow washes that funnel directly into the canyon’s cracks. As torrents of muddy water plunge downward, they carry sand and debris that scour and polish the Navajo Sandstone. Each flood deepens the canyon a little more, sculpting the smooth, flowing curves we see today.

Shape – Narrow, Smooth, and Wave-Like Walls

True to the definition of a slot canyon, Antelope Canyon is extremely narrow—at points, less than a few feet wide—but drops dramatically in depth. Its walls are silky smooth, undulating like frozen waves. The narrow passages twist and turn, creating a dreamlike labyrinth that perfectly embodies the “slot” structure.

Location – Arid Colorado Plateau

Antelope Canyon sits squarely within the Colorado Plateau, a vast region of high desert that spans several southwestern U.S. states. This arid environment, with its combination of soft sandstone layers, sparse vegetation, and occasional violent storms, provides ideal conditions for slot canyon formation. Few other regions on Earth offer such a perfect setting.

A Living Example of Nature’s Design

Antelope Canyon is the textbook definition of a slot canyon:

  • It is much deeper than it is wide, in some places only a few feet across but over 120 feet deep.
  • Its walls are made of fine-grained sandstone, shaped by flash flood erosion.
  • It was formed on a tectonically uplifted plateau, where cracks guided the path of erosion.

When sunlight filters through the narrow opening above, the beams illuminate the canyon’s curving walls in shades of orange, gold, and violet—visual proof of the water and time that carved it.
